I have an OEM JDM ITR valve cover for my GSR engine and I got my cam gears. However My only guess to cutting the valve cover is to slice the side right off to expose them for tuning. What have you guys done and do you guys have pics? Any help is appreciated.

Or you could get a air compressor...and a cutting disc..trace a line where you want to cut it...and go on with the process.
1)dont' do it when the valve cover is on the head.
2)You can get a cutting disc at any hardware store along with the adapter for the air tool.
3)Don't make the opening too big to where something can fall in and screw things up
